"Service方法"這個詞組可以指向兩個不同的概念,具體取決於上下文:
Android中的Service方法:
onCreate(): 當Service第一次被創建後立即回調該方法,在整個生命周期中只會調用一次。
onStartCommand(): 當客戶端調用startService()方法時會回調此方法,可多次調用startService()方法,但不會再創建新的Service對象,而是繼續復用當前Service對象,但會繼續調用onStartCommand()方法。
onDestroy(): 當Service被關閉時調用該方法。
onUnbind(intent): 當該Service上綁定的所有客戶端都斷開時會調用該方法。
Servlet中的service()方法:
在Servlet API中,service()方法是請求的入口方法。HttpServlet實現service()方法,在這個入口方法中根據不同的Http請求方法(如GET、POST請求)調用不同的方法。
根據上下文,"service方法"可以指向上述任一概念。在Android開發中,Service是後台執行操作的重要組件,而Servlet是Web應用程式中的一個重要組件。了解具體的上下文可以幫助更準確地解釋"service方法"的含義。